Picking a captain has become more difficult with multiple interchanges. Picking a forward means there's a good possibility your skipper will be off the field when needed. You need an 80 minute playe who's vocal enough to fire up the team yet diplomatic enough to deal with the officials. They should be close to the action so decisions can be made quickly Eg. quick taps etc. Ideally, they'll also be able to provide a professional face for the media.

Benji ticks all the boxes, but you can't lead from the benches.

Given the criteria, I suspect Mbye is there through attrition rather than ability.
